首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ysqldump备份数据库

mysqldump是MySQL数据库管理系统中的一个命令行工具,用于备份数据库。它可以将整个数据库或特定的表导出为一个SQL文件,以便在需要时进行恢复或迁移。

mysqldump的主要功能包括:

  1. 备份数据库:通过执行mysqldump命令,可以将数据库的结构和数据导出到一个SQL文件中,以便后续恢复或迁移数据库。
  2. 数据库迁移:通过将mysqldump生成的SQL文件导入到另一个MySQL服务器中,可以实现数据库的迁移。
  3. 数据库复制:可以使用mysqldump备份主数据库,并将备份文件导入到从数据库中,从而实现数据库的复制。
  4. 数据库版本控制:通过将mysqldump生成的SQL文件纳入版本控制系统,可以跟踪数据库结构和数据的变化,并在需要时进行回滚或恢复。

mysqldump的优势:

  1. 简单易用:mysqldump是一个命令行工具,使用简单,只需执行一个命令即可完成备份操作。
  2. 灵活性:mysqldump可以备份整个数据库或特定的表,可以选择备份结构、数据或两者同时备份。
  3. 可移植性:备份的结果是一个SQL文件,可以在任何支持MySQL的环境中进行恢复,无需担心不同数据库版本的兼容性问题。

mysqldump的应用场景:

  1. 数据库备份和恢复:mysqldump可以定期备份数据库,以防止数据丢失,同时也可以使用备份文件进行数据库的恢复。
  2. 数据库迁移和复制:通过将mysqldump生成的SQL文件导入到其他MySQL服务器中,可以实现数据库的迁移和复制。
  3. 数据库版本控制:将mysqldump生成的SQL文件纳入版本控制系统,可以跟踪数据库结构和数据的变化,并在需要时进行回滚或恢复。

腾讯云相关产品和产品介绍链接地址:

腾讯云提供了多个与数据库备份相关的产品和服务,其中包括:

  1. 云数据库 MySQL:腾讯云提供的托管式MySQL数据库服务,支持自动备份和恢复功能。详情请参考:https://cloud.tencent.com/product/cdb
  2. 云数据库备份服务:腾讯云提供的数据库备份服务,支持自动备份和手动备份,可以对MySQL数据库进行全量备份和增量备份。详情请参考:https://cloud.tencent.com/product/dcdb-backup
  3. 云数据库灾备服务:腾讯云提供的数据库灾备服务,可以实现数据库的异地备份和灾难恢复。详情请参考:https://cloud.tencent.com/product/dcdb-disaster-recovery

请注意,以上仅为腾讯云提供的部分相关产品和服务,其他云计算品牌商也提供类似的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券